2009 SWAC Baseball Tournament Pairings Set

swac.gifBIRMINGHAM – The 2009 Southwestern Athletic Conference baseball tournament pairings are now set for next week’s tournament at Southern University’s Lee-Hines Field in Baton Rouge, LA.

This year’s championship is scheduled for Wednesday May 20-Sunday May 24 and begins with four games on Day 1. #3 East seed Alcorn State will play #2 West seed Univ. Arkansas-Pine Bluff at 9 a.m. Game 2 will feature #3 West seed Grambling State, which clinched a tournament berth Saturday with a win, taking on #2 East seed Jackson State at noon.

The top divisional seeds will be in action later in the day. At 3 p.m. #1 East seed Mississippi Valley State will take on #4 West seed and 2008 defending champion Texas Southern. The final game of the day will feature #1 West seed Southern facing #4 East seed Alabama A&M at 6 p.m.

Action will continue Thursday and Friday with four games each day at 9 a.m., Noon, 3 p.m., and 6 p.m. Saturday, a pair of ‘if necessary’ games are scheduled for Noon and 3 p.m..

Sunday, the championship game will be played at 1 p.m. and televised on tape-delay basis later that day at 7 p.m. on ESPNU.

Wednesday, May 20

Game 1 Alcorn St. vs. Univ. Arkansas-Pine Bluff 9 a.m.
Game 2 Grambling St. vs. Jackson St. Noon
Game 3 Texas Southern vs. Mississippi Valley St. 3 p.m.
Game 4 Alabama A&M vs. Southern 6:00 p.m.

Thursday, May 21

Game 5 Game 1 loser vs. Game 3 loser 9:00 a.m.
Game 6 Game 2 loser vs. Game 4 loser Noon
Game 7 Game 1 winner vs. Game 3 winner 3:00 p.m.
Game 8 Game 2 winner vs. Game 4 winner 6:00 p.m.

Friday, May 22

Game 9 Game 5 winner vs. Game 7 Loser 9:00 a.m.
Game 10 Game 6 winner vs. Game 8 Loser Noon
Game 11 Game 7 Winner vs. Game 9 Winner 3:00 p.m.
Game 12 Game 8 Winner vs. Game 10 Winner 6:00 p.m.

Saturday, May 23

Game 13 (if necessary) Game 11 winner vs. Game 11 loser Noon
Game 14 (if necessary) Game 12 winner vs. Game 12 loser 3 p.m.

Sunday, May 24

Game 15 Championship Game 1:00 p.m.
